By Dr. Robert Pretzel Logic is the third studio album by the American jazz-rock band Steely Dan, originally released in 1974. The album's opening song, "Rikki Don't Lose That Number", became the band's biggest hit, reaching #4 on the charts soon after the release of the album. The album itself went gold...

By Dr. Robert Steely Dan - Katy Lied Katy Lied is the fourth album by Steely Dan, released in 1975. It went gold and peaked at #13 on the US charts. The single "Black Friday" also charted at #37. Band members Walter Becker and Donald Fagen were not happy with the album's sound quality due to an equipment malfun...

By Dr. Robert The Nightfly is the first solo album by Steely Dan co-founder Donald Fagen, released in 1982. It was one of the first fully digital recordings of popular music. In the UK the album was certified Platinum in 2004, despite only reaching #44 on the charts following its release. It has also gone pl...
